Yes: Pregnancy dating is very important so an early ultrasound is very helpful. Patients will bleed about 12-14 days after ovulation unless they are pregnant. Thus the date of ovulation not the date of your previous menstrual cycle determines your gestational age. If you have regular 28 day cycles then these two yield the same gestational age but in cases of irregular cycles all bets are off....
